Freudian Dream Interpretation: Sigmund Freud, the father of psychoanalysis, believed that dreams were a manifestation of repressed desires and unconscious thoughts. In the Freudian interpretation, killing a mouse could represent the suppression or destruction of a small, innocent part of oneself. This could signify the act of suppressing one's inner child or repressing certain emotions or desires.

For example, if a person dreams of killing a mouse while feeling guilty, it could indicate that they are suppressing a playful or innocent part of themselves due to societal expectations or personal inhibitions.

Jungian Dream Interpretation: Carl Jung, a renowned psychologist, saw dreams as a way of exploring the collective unconscious and connecting with archetypes. In the Jungian interpretation, killing a mouse could symbolize the conquering of one's fears or the eradication of a nagging issue. It could also represent the need to assert control over a situation or aspect of one's life.

For instance, if a person dreams of killing a mouse while feeling empowered, it may suggest that they are overcoming their anxieties or taking charge of a problematic situation that has been bothering them.

Cognitive Dream Interpretation: The cognitive theory of dreams focuses on the idea that dreams are a reflection of the dreamer's current thoughts, feelings, and experiences. According to this interpretation, killing a mouse in a dream could reflect a sense of accomplishment or the desire to eliminate obstacles in one's life.

Suppose a person dreams of killing a mouse and experiences a sense of relief afterward. In that case, it may indicate that they have successfully dealt with a minor problem or are taking steps towards resolving a situation that has been bothering them.
